Lui is a street dancer from the Suwa region who appears as a supporting character in Tribe Cool Crew. He performs as one half of a dance duo alongside his partner Moe. The pair are known for their flamboyant attitude and strong attachment to their own team color, which they call Suwa Blue. They take great pride in their appearance and frequently declare their intention to dye the entire world in their color. Their signature dance style is called Suwa-kyou SWAG, and they have a trademark footwork sequence known as the RuiRui Step that can even trace letters on the ground. Lui's primary motivation is to become famous and wealthy, with the ultimate goal of surpassing the iconic dancer Jey El and becoming the new face of dance. He is also driven by a desire to achieve recognition and financial success, often speaking about becoming a millionaire. In the story, Lui and Moe first encounter the main characters Haneru and Kanon during a road trip to Lake Suwa, where they rescue the pair from a group of delinquents. Later, they are recruited by the antagonist Gallagher and are introduced to a forbidden dance known as Cloud High, which grants immense power but gradually damages the dancer's body. Under its influence, Lui becomes arrogant and dismissive of others. However, during a dance battle with Kumonosuke and Mizuki, the physical strain becomes too much and he collapses. This experience leads him to realize the error of his ways, and he returns to his original, more grounded self. After this turning point, Lui and Moe reform their team and add the prefix New to their group name. Lui's relationship with Moe is central to his identity, as the two function as a tightly knit pair with a shared vision. He also develops a more respectful dynamic with the main Tribe Cool Crew members following his redemption. His notable abilities include the Suwa-kyou SWAG dance routine, the precise RuiRui Step, and later the dangerous Cloud High technique, which he ultimately forgoes.
